Least Common Multiple of 93912 and 93927 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 93912 and 93927, than apply into the LCM equation.

GCF(93912,93927) = 3
LCM(93912,93927) = ( 93912 × 93927) / 3
LCM(93912,93927) = 8820872424 / 3
LCM(93912,93927) = 2940290808
